Introduction and aim. Sorafenib has been the standard of care for first-line treatment of advanced hepatocellular carcinoma, a complex disease that affects an extremely heterogenous population. Thereby requiring multidisciplinary individualized treatment strategies that match the disease characteristics and the patients’ specific needs. Material and methods. Data for 175 patients who received sorafenib for hepatocellular carcinoma in three different hospitals in Sao Paulo, Brazil over a span of nine years were retrospectively analyzed. Results. The median age was 62 years. Percentages of patients with Child-Pugh A, B and C liver cirrhosis were 61%, 31% and 5%, respectively. Approximately half of the patients had Barcelona Clinic Liver Cancer stage B disease, and the other half had stage C. The median treatment duration was 253 days. Sorafenib dose was reduced to 400 mg/day in 41% of the patients due to toxicity. Overall objective response rate as per Response Evaluation Criteria in Solid Tumors and its modified version was 39%. Patients who received transarterial chemoembolization (TACE) at any point during sorafenib therapy were significantly more likely to experience an objective response. After a median follow-up of 339 days, the median overall survival was 380 days. Child-Pugh cirrhosis, tumor response and concomitant chemoembolization were independent prognostic factors for overall survival in multivariate analysis. Conclusion. Our results suggest that, in experienced hands, sorafenib therapy may benefit carefully selected hepatocellular carcinoma patients for whom other therapies are initially contraindicated, including those patients with Child-Pugh B liver function and those patients who are subsequently treated with concomitant TACE.

Abstract Purpose To explore the potential correlation between baseline interleukin (IL) values and overall survival or objective response in patients with hepatocellular carcinoma (HCC) receiving sorafenib. Methods A subset of patients with HCC undergoing sorafenib monotherapy within a prospective multicenter phase II trial (SORAMIC, sorafenib treatment alone vs. combined with Y90 radioembolization) underwent baseline IL-6 and IL-8 assessment before treatment initiation. In this exploratory post hoc analysis, the best cut-off points for baseline IL-6 and IL-8 values predicting overall survival (OS) were evaluated, as well as correlation with the objective response. Results Forty-seven patients (43 male) with a median OS of 13.8 months were analyzed. Cut-off values of 8.58 and 57.9 pg/mL most effectively predicted overall survival for IL-6 and IL-8, respectively. Patients with high IL-6 (HR, 4.1 [1.9–8.9], p < 0.001) and IL-8 (HR, 2.4 [1.2–4.7], p = 0.009) had significantly shorter overall survival than patients with low IL values. Multivariate analysis confirmed IL-6 (HR, 2.99 [1.22–7.3], p = 0.017) and IL-8 (HR, 2.19 [1.02–4.7], p = 0.044) as independent predictors of OS. Baseline IL-6 and IL-8 with respective cut-off values predicted objective response rates according to mRECIST in a subset of 42 patients with follow-up imaging available (IL-6, 46.6% vs. 19.2%, p = 0.007; IL-8, 50.0% vs. 17.4%, p = 0.011). Conclusion IL-6 and IL-8 baseline values predicted outcomes of sorafenib-treated patients in this well-characterized prospective cohort of the SORAMIC trial. We suggest that the respective cut-off values might serve for validation in larger cohorts, potentially offering guidance for improved patient selection.

Objective: To evaluate the feasibility, efficacy and safety of transcatheter arterial chemoembolization (TACE) with HepaSphere for patients with pulmonary or mediastinal metastases from hepatocellular carcinoma (HCC). Methods: Between June 2009 and January 2018, 14 patients with pulmonary or mediastinal metastases from HCC were treated with TACE with a combination of 1–3 chemotherapeutic drugs followed by HepaSphere embolization. As first end point, local tumor response and adverse events were evaluated after the first session of TACE, with Response Evaluation Criteria In Solid Tumors v. 1.1 and Common Terminology Criteria for Adverse Events v. 4 criteria, respectively. Overall survival was evaluated as secondary end point. TACE was repeated on-demand. Results: TACE with HepaSphere was well tolerated with acceptable safety profile and no 30 day mortality. 1 month objective response and disease control rate were calculated to be 7.1 and 100%, respectively. Mean tumor size reduction rate was 15.6±9.5% at the first month. Two Grade 3 cytopenia events were seen (14.3 %), however none of the Grade 2 or more post-embolization syndrome was observed. The median overall survival time was 15.0 months and the 1 year, 3 year and 5 year survival rate were, 57.1%, 28.6%, 19.1%, respectively. Conclusion: Early experience showed that the transarterial treatment with HepaSphere is safe and effective treatment for patients with pulmonary or mediastinal metastases from HCC. Advances in knowledge: Currently, the effects of molecular targeted drugs on HCC metastases are limited and side-effects are relatively frequent. In the present study, transarterial treatment might be a promising treatment for HCC metastasis.

e14701 Background: To investigate the application value and strategies of ultrasound-guided percutaneous radiofrequency ablation (RFA) in treating advanced hepatocellular carcinoma (HCC) which is common in china. Methods: A total of 655 patients with unresectablely advanced HCC underwent percuatenous RFA therapy and 92 patients with 136 tumors among them were enrolled into the study. According to the 6th UICC/AJCC-TNM system, 82 and 10 patients were in stage III and IV, respectively. The tumor size ranged from 1.5 to 8.0 cm (mean±SD, 4.5±1.6 cm). 59 patients had solitary tumor and the remaining 33 patients had multiple tumors. The Child-Pugh classification of A, B and C were 58,32 and 2 patients, respectively. Established strategies included: (1) select RFA indications based on the contrast-enhanced ultrasound (CEUS) results; (2) design radical protocols based on invasive range showed by CEUS; (3) multiple overlapping ablations based on mathematical protocol; (4) two or three bipolar RFA electrodes with three dimensional localization; (5) color US guided percutaneous ablation of tumor feeding artery (including TACE) + RFA for HCC with rich supply. The patients underwent follow-up using enhanced CT at one month, and then every three months after RFA. The ablation was considered a success if no abnormal enhancement or wash-out was detected in the treated area on the CT scan at one month. All patients after RFA received liver protection treatments. Overall survival was estimated by Kaplan-Meier analysis. Results: Early complete tumor necrosis rate after initial RFA was 90.4% (123/136 tumors). Serious complications were developed in two patients (2.2%) and no treatment-related death occurred. 3~129 months were followed up. Local recurrence rate was 15.4 %(21/136 tumors). The 1-, 3-, 5-year overall survival rates were 83.3 %, 48.3 %, 21.9%, respectively, and the median survival time was 35 months. Conclusions: RFA treatment of advanced HCC proved to be feasible. Paying attention to apply treatment strategies and liver protection therapies in RFA can effectively improve the survival.

e15678 Background: Patients with advanced hepatocellular carcinoma (HCC) have a particularly poor prognosis of the median overall survival of less than 12 months. Even though sorafenib has been approved for treating advanced stage HCC, the unsatisfactory objective response rate still remain unresolved. In the current study, we aimed to evaluate the efficacy and safety of localized concurrent chemoradiotherapy (CCRT) followed by sequential sorafenib treatment for advanced hepatocellular carcinoma. Methods: This study is an ongoing, phase II trial. Patients with advanced HCC not amenable for curative treatments were eligible. In the course of radiotherapy for 5 weeks, hepatic arterial infusion of 5-fluorouracil (500mg/day) via implanted port was applied during the first 5 days and the last 5 days of radiotherapy. Four weeks after localized CCRT, sorafenib (400mg bid) was maintained. The primary endpoint was overall survival. Results: A total of 47 patients were enrolled. After the completion of localized CCRT, the objective response rate was 31.9%. During the overall treatment course, the objective response rate was 46.8% respectively. Overall, 7 patients (14.9%) underwent curative resection or transplantation after down-staging. The median overall survival was 18.4 months and the progression-free survival was 6.8 months. Adverse events were predictable and manageable with conservative care. Conclusions: Localized CCRT followed by sequential sorafenib treatment in patients with advanced HCC showed significant activity and good tolerability. Furthermore, such a treatment modality, when compared to the use of sorafenib alone, might provide the additional therapeutic benefit through initial tumor reduction, allowing curative treatment after down-staging in 14.9% of patients, Further randomized trial should be required to make the more robust evidence. <b><i>Aim:</i></b> Atezolizumab plus bevacizumab (atezo + bev) shows a good overall survival (OS) in advanced hepatocellular carcinoma (HCC) patients. However, the OS of patients with nonviral infection is quite worse than that in those with viral infection. The present study investigated the efficacy and safety of lenvatinib in patients with nonviral infection, who were unlikely to obtain benefit from atezo + bev. <b><i>Methods:</i></b> We conducted a multicenter retrospective study that included 139 advanced HCC patients treated with lenvatinib between March 2018 and September 2020. <b><i>Results:</i></b> The median age was 72 years, and 116 patients (83.5%) were male. Based on the etiology of liver disease, 84 (60.4%) and 55 patients (39.6%) were assigned to the viral infection and nonviral infection groups, respectively. The significant extents in patient characteristics were not observed in both groups. The objective response rate per mRECIST and progression-free survival (PFS) did not differ significantly between the viral infection and nonviral infection groups (36.0 vs. 33.0%, <i>p</i> = 0.85; and 7.6 vs. 7.5 months, <i>p</i> = 0.94, respectively). The 1-year survival rates were 68.7% (95% confidence interval [CI] 57.7–79.7%) in the viral infection group and 59.5% (95% CI 45.2–73.8%) in the nonviral infection group. The viral infection group was not a significant factor associated with the PFS or OS in a multivariate analysis. <b><i>Conclusions:</i></b> Lenvatinib shows no significant difference in response between patients with and without viral infection. Treatment strategies based on the etiology of liver disease may lead to good clinical outcome.

Abstract Purpose The activity of targeted agents and immunotherapy in the management of advanced hepatocellular carcinoma (HCC) is reviewed. Summary The first drug approved by the Food and Drug Administration for advanced HCC, sorafenib, was approved in 2007. Regorafenib, the second drug, was approved 10 years later. Six additional drugs have been approved since. Targeted agents and checkpoint inhibitors are the only agents approved for systemic therapy of advanced HCC. Sorafenib and lenvatinib are approved as first-line agents, with regorafenib, cabozantinib, ramucirumab, nivolumab (used alone or with ipilimumab), and pembrolizumab approved for patients who have received prior sorafenib therapy. Most patients in phase 3 studies had Child-Pugh class A cirrhosis, and data on the use of these agents in patients with more advanced hepatic dysfunction are limited. All of the targeted agents improve survival in patients with advanced disease. Median overall survival durations of up to 12.3 and 13.6 months were reported with use of sorafenib and lenvatinib, respectively, in phase 3 trials. Overall survival durations of 10.6, 10.2, and 9.2 months have been achieved with use of regorafenib, cabozantinib, and ramucirumab as second-line therapy after sorafenib. A median overall survival of 13.2 months was reported in 1 cohort of a dose-expansion study of nivolumab in which all patients received prior sorafenib therapy. Median survival durations of 12.9 months and 13.9 months were reported with use of pembrolizumab in patients with a history of sorafenib therapy. The most common adverse effects associated with targeted agents are dermatological effects, diarrhea, fatigue, and hypertension. Immune-mediated adverse effects are associated with checkpoint inhibitors. Conclusion Targeted agents and checkpoint inhibitors are the standard of therapy for patients who need systemic therapy for advanced HCC.

Background In SILIUS (NCT01214343), combination of sorafenib and hepatic arterial infusion chemotherapy did not significantly improve overall survival in patients with advanced hepatocellular carcinoma (HCC) compared with sorafenib alone. In this study, we explored the relationship between objective response by mRECIST and overall survival (OS) in the sorafenib group, in the combination group and in all patients in the SILIUS trial. Methods Association between objective response and OS in patients treated with sorafenib (n=103), combination (n=102) and all patients (n=205) were analyzed. The median OS of responders was compared with that of non-responders. Landmark analyses were performed according to objective response at several fixed time points, as sensitivity analyses, and the effect on OS was evaluated by Cox regression analysis with objective response as a time-dependent covariate, with other prognostic factors was performed. Results In the sorafenib group, OS of responders (n = 18) was significantly better than that of non-responders (n = 78) (p &lt; 0.0001), where median OS was 27.2 (95% CI, 16.0&ndash;not reached) months for responders and 8.9 (95% CI, 6.5&ndash;12.6) months for non-responders. HRs from landmark analyses at 4, 6, and 8 months were 0.45 (p=0.0330), 0.37 (p=0.0053), and 0.36 (p=0.0083), respectively. Objective response was an independent predictor of OS based on unstratified Cox regression analyses. In the all patients and the combination group, similar results were obtained. Conclusion In the SILIUS trial, objective response was an independent prognostic factor for OS in patients with HCC.

316 Background: In the phase III CELESTIAL trial, cabozantinib showed significant improvement in overall survival with good tolerability in advanced HCC population. We aimed to evaluate the efficacy, survival and tolerability of cabozatinib in advanced hepatocellular carcinoma (HCC) patients in a real life setting. Methods: Between February 2018 and October 2019, consecutive advanced HCC patients who received cabozatinib alone or in combination at University of Hong Kong Health System hospitals were analysed. Cabozantinib was administered at 60 mg continuously daily. Objective response rate (ORR), time-to-progression (TTP), overall survival (OS), and tolerability were evaluated. Results: Overall, 22 patients were included. The median age was 57.1 years (range 48.5-58.6). All patients except one were hepatitis B carriers. More than 80% of the patients had underlying Child-Pugh A cirrhosis. Most patients had metastatic disease (95.5%). More than 70% of patients received cabozantinib beyond second-line, and most of the patients had prior exposure to tyrosine kinase inhibitor (TKI) and/or immunotherapy. The median time from the start of first-line systemic treatment to the start of cabozantinib was 11.2 months. Cabozantinib was administered to 11 patients (50%) as single agent, while the other half received cabozantinib in combination with mostly immune checkpoint inhibitors. The median follow-up was 7.6 months. The table below shows the ORR. The overall median TTP and OS were 4.2 and 8.90 months, respectively. Interestingly, among those who received single agent cabozantinib, the median OS was 5.36 months in contrast to 12.32 months in the patients received combination. Overall, 90.9% of patients experienced treatment related adverse events (TRAEs) with transient liver function occurred in nearly 50% patients. Nevertheless, Grade 3/4 TRAEs was only 12%. Background/Aim: The aim of this study was to investigate the outcomes of atezolizumab plus bevacizumab in patients with advanced hepatocellular carcinoma (HCC), including those with disease refractory to lenvatinib, in clinical practice. Patients and Methods: Of 34 patients treated with atezolizumab plus bevacizumab, a total of 23, including 16 with lenvatinib failure, were enrolled in this retrospective study. The adverse events, changes in liver function and antitumor responses at 6 weeks after starting therapy were evaluated. Results: The incidence of grade 3 adverse events was low, at 13.0%. Albumin–bilirubin scores did not worsen at 3 and 6 weeks compared to baseline. The objective response rate and disease control rate at 6 weeks were 17.4% and 78.3% according to Response Evaluation Criteria in Solid Tumors (RECIST), and 30.4% and 78.3% according to modified RECIST, respectively. Conclusion: Our results suggest that atezolizumab plus bevacizumab might have potential therapeutic safety and efficacy in patients with advanced HCC, including those with disease refractory to lenvatinib. Further studies are needed to confirm the outcomes of atezolizumab plus bevacizumab after lenvatinib failure.

e15632 Background: Hepatocellular carcinoma (HCC) is a common malignant disease. Promising results of prospective clinical trials using systemic therapy for patients with advanced HCC are emerging. The aim of this study was to explore prognostic factors of survival in advanced HCC patients eligible for clinical trials of systemic therapy. Methods: From December 1990 to July 2005, 236 patients with unresectable HCC were enrolled into 6 phase II trials of systemic therapy using the following regimens: (1) oral etoposide + tamoxifen, (2)doxorubicin + tamoxifen, (3)IFN-α2b + doxorubicin + tamoxifen, (4)pegylated liposomal doxorubicin, (5)thalidomide, and (6)arsenic trioxide. Univariate and multivariate analyses of 23 relevant clinical characteristics/staging systems were used to identify prognostic factors of survival. Results: Baseline characteristics: median age 55; male/female: 192/44; HBsAg(+) 71%; anti-HCV(+) 30%; Okuda stage I/II/III: 42%/55%/3%; AJCC stage III/IV: 30%/61%; BCLC stage B/C/D: 1%/94%/5%; CLIP score 0–3/4–6: 70%/30%; portal vein thrombosis 53%; extrahepatic metastasis 59%; prior chemoembolization 46%. The objective response rate according to WHO criteria was 11.4%. The median overall survival was 118 days (95% CI, 103–133). In the multivariate analysis, significant predictors of a shorter overall survival were: HBsAg(+) with a hazard ratio (HR) = 1.808 (95% CI, 1.121–2.916; P= 0.015), symptomatic with HR = 1.745 (95% CI, 1.072–2.840; P= 0.025), ECOG≥2 with HR = 1.763 (95% CI, 1.040–2.988; P= 0.035), and high BCLC stage with HR = 3.282 (95% CI, 1.129–9.541; P= 0.029). Conclusions: Patients with advanced HCC who are eligible for systemic therapeutic trials have patient- and disease-related prognostic factors.
